Re: i'm new, heres what i've got.
dont like the look of extended fronts so kept it normal, engine and frame are gonna have to come out to change the oil filter as a result but small price to pay imo. its a b16a1 out of a crx, some people say it puts out 160 bhp but i think its 150 which is plenty for what i'm after.
